Throw the Gauntlet is a rogue talent from the Duelist specialization in Dragon Age II.

Information

Enemy will engage you

Upgrades

To the Death To the Death
Upgrade
Requires: Level 12
Requires: 2 points in Duelist
The rogue's opponent is completely absorbed in this duel. For a short time, the enemy will not seek a new target unless either combatant falls. The enraged foe also attacks carelessly, inflicting less damage against the rogue.

Enemy will not seek new target
Enemy damage: -25%
Cutting Barbs Cutting Barbs
Upgrade
Duration: 20s
Requires: Level 14
Requires: 4 points in Duelist
The duelist taunts the enemy into lowering its guard.

Enemy defense: -50%

Trivia

  • "Throwing the Gauntlet" was a European practice in the Middle Ages. A warrior, most often a knight or lord, would issue a challenge to their rival by taking off their gauntlet and throwing it at their rival's feet. The rival was then forced to pick up the gauntlet, accepting the challenge, or else risk their honor and pride by denying the challenge.
